Apple Rises 2%: Can $100B Buyback Outweigh Inventory Pressure?
Apple reported fiscal Q2 2026 revenue of $111.2 billion, up 17% year-over-year and an all-time record for the March quarter, coming in above the high end of prior guidance. China revenue posted another double-digit increase, iPhone revenue hit a same-period record, and current-quarter guidance surprised to the upside. CFO signaled abandonment of the long-held net-cash-neutral target alongside a fresh $100 billion buyback authorization. Can the buyback underpin the stock, and how significant will memory cost headwinds prove to be?
